H.R. 4226 (104th)

To require approval of an application for compensation for the injuries of Eugene Hasenfus.

Summary

Deems a named individual to have been a Federal employee in the performance of his duties at the time of his injury for purposes of determining eligibility for worker's compensation. Requires the individual's application to be approved and payments to be made as computed by the Secretary of Labor.
